Output 67f86c30925ab587136b4f60c1d3e618734e558a75d35e49d6b779fd3bc8b303:0

value
510953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40372b3417406581b9a35064a83b9a3ada20dc7 OP_EQUAL
address
3NUe7raeLz4EyNoH2ay5Me34Lo8Lcm1vB9
transaction
67f86c30925ab587136b4f60c1d3e618734e558a75d35e49d6b779fd3bc8b303
spent
true